The durability of the Leopard pattern bed sheets depends heavily on the method used to apply the print. Modern digital printing and sublimation techniques ensure that the colors penetrate the fibers rather than sitting on top, which prevents cracking and fading over time. To ensure a perfect fit, consider the following factors: <dl> <dt style="font-weight:bold;"> <strong> Fitted Sheet Depth </strong> </dt> <dd> The vertical measurement from the top edge of the sheet to the bottom hem, determining how well it fits mattresses of varying thicknesses. </dd> <dt style="font-weight:bold;"> <strong> Flat Sheet Drop </strong> </dt> <dd> The length of the flat sheet, which should be long enough to hang over the sides of the bed by at least 10-12 inches for a polished look. </dd> </dl> If you are unsure about the size, here is a quick reference guide: <table> <thead> <tr> <th> Bed Size </th> <th> Mattress Width </th> <th> Mattress Length </th> <th> Recommended Sheet Drop </th> </tr> </thead> <tbody> <tr> <td> <strong> Twin </strong> </td> <td> 38 inches </td> <td> 75 inches </td> <td> 10 inches </td> </tr> <tr> <td> <strong> Full </strong> </td> <td> 54 inches </td> <td> 75 inches </td> <td> 12 inches </td> </tr> <tr> <td> <strong> Queen </strong> </td> <td> 60 inches </td> <td> 80 inches </td> <td> 14 inches </td> </tr> <tr> <td> <strong> King </strong> </td> <td> 76 inches </td> <td> 80 inches </td> <td> 16 inches </td> </tr> </tbody> </table> As an expert in floral and textile design, my advice is to always measure your mattress, including any mattress toppers, before ordering. If the product listing does not specify the depth, contact the seller for clarification.
